Jeffrey Pai is a scholar working on Economics and Econometrics, Soil Science and Statistics and Probability.
According to data from OpenAlex, Jeffrey Pai has authored 26 papers receiving a total of 250 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Economics and Econometrics, 11 papers in Soil Science and 7 papers in Statistics and Probability. Recurrent topics in Jeffrey Pai’s work include Agricultural risk and resilience (11 papers), Insurance and Financial Risk Management (8 papers) and Financial Risk and Volatility Modeling (6 papers). Jeffrey Pai is often cited by papers focused on Agricultural risk and resilience (11 papers), Insurance and Financial Risk Management (8 papers) and Financial Risk and Volatility Modeling (6 papers). Jeffrey Pai collaborates with scholars based in Canada, United States and China. Jeffrey Pai's co-authors include Milton S. Boyd, Налини Равишанкер, Qiao Zhang and Ke Wang and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Econometrics, Computational Statistics & Data Analysis and Insurance Mathematics and Economics.
